US Regulatory Advertising and Promotion (US Reg AD/Promo) is responsible for actively contributing to the implementation of regulatory strategy for promotional messaging. The contractor will serve as the regulatory representative on assigned review teams for promotional and non-promotional materials and contribute, as appropriate, to other assigned projects.

Essential functions:
  • Responsible for accuracy and content of communications with FDA
  • Extensive knowledge of advertising and promotion regulations and ability to interpret regulations to promotional materials and non-promotional materials
  • Ability to influence teams
  • Actively contribute to the development and implementation of regulatory strategy for promotional materials as well as any other assigned projects and programs.
  • Decision maker in review meetings
  • Responsible for coordinating all aspects of regulatory submissions relevant to assigned projects and programs. This includes promotional materials, including pre-use submissions for subpart E & H products.
  • Provide regulatory guidance to cross-functional teams that establish strategy and vision for promotional materials, sales training materials, and other external communications.
  • Work is performed under general direction. Capable of strategic thinking and risk assessment for area of responsibility. Demonstrate good communication skills (oral/written/listening).

Qualifications: Requires a minimum of 5+ yrs of direct regulatory promotional and non-promotional material review experience.
